Or stay here was pretty good when we first arrived the people at the front desk were very friendly and welcoming. Our room was very clean and the bed was comfortable. There were a few amenities such as face soap, small packages of lotion and such. During our stay, there was plenty of parking and though it is off of the main road it felt safe. There were only two complaints that we had about this stay if we had to mention any. The walls are very thin so you could hear the traffic that is outside and any sirens that passed by during the night but it wasn’t anything to keep you from sleeping. On the second day, our keys stopped working for some reason but a quick trip to the office got that corrected in no time I highly recommend this location if you’re looking for a comfortable bed and nice clean place to stay the night.
I had a pleasant stay at Hotel Casa Blanca. The reservation process was simple, and everything was smooth upon arrival. The hotel has a quiet and discreet atmosphere, which makes it ideal for a restful stay.
The entrance is not very noticeable at first because it’s a bit tiny, but the hotel is located right next to another motel, making it easier to identify. The room was clean, comfortable, and well maintained. The staff at the front desk was friendly and helpful. And actually is the first time that I see a really polite person.
Overall, this is a good option for travelers looking for a simple, private, and comfortable place to stay. I would consider staying here again.
